Individually manufactured reading lights in the freehand magazine
The Alexis de Tocqueville Library designed by OMA / Rem Kohlhaas in cooperation with Chris van Duijn is a public library for the metropolitan region of Caen la Mer in Normandy, France. Reading spaces within the 12,000 m² multimedia library section are illuminated by 78 custom-length potsdam LED table lamps.
